RIFLE SHOOTING.
W.B.A. MEETING. It is expected that record entries will be received by to-day for the Wellington Hide Association's championship meeting, which takes place on Boxing Day, and tho following day, December 26 and 27. Last yeir the entries totalled 170, making the meeting the biggest outside tlmt of tho Dominion Rifle Association, and entries so far received this year indicate that that number will be. reached, if not exceeded. The entries includo James, of Hastings, tho present Now Zealand champion. The Mayor (Mr. J. V. Luke), president of the association, has promised to go oat to Trentham to witness the shooting _on the second day. Riflemen are particularly requested to note that the only train available for competitors leaves for Trentham from Lambton Station at 6.35 a.m. on Boxing Day.
